[Detailed Description of the Invention] (Technical Field) The present invention relates to a tool holder for organizing and storing tools such as a chucking tool or a taper shank for holding the chucking tool in a cabinet, wagon, etc. It is something.

(Prior art) As a conventional tool holder of this type, it was developed in 1983.
"Holder for tool storage" described in Publication No. 78088
There is a fitting groove on the inner surface,
It has a flange edge on the front and back of the outside, and one flange edge is extended inward by an appropriate length and has a lug tooth carved into it, and the other brim edge is engraved with a lug tooth that meshes with the above-mentioned lug tooth. The pair of retaining members provided are assembled so that the rack teeth mesh with each other and the fitting grooves face each other, and by changing the meshing of the rack teeth, the distance between the fitting grooves can be changed, and the tool The handle of the fitting groove is held between the side walls of the fitting groove.

In other words, this holder was a two-point support in which the handle of the tool was held between the side walls of the pair of fitting grooves, so in order to support the handle of the tool without wobbling, the side walls of the fitting groove had to be supported. must have a curved surface equal to the curvature of the outer circumferential surface of the handle of the tool with the largest diameter. Therefore, unless the diameter of the handle of the tool to be held exceeds the maximum distance between the side walls of the fitting grooves when the holding members are in close contact with each other, there is a risk that the tool may wobble and fall sideways during transportation.

(Purpose of the invention) In order to eliminate and solve the problems of the above-mentioned conventional technology, the present invention supports tools at three or more points so that tools from the largest diameter to the smallest diameter may fall down during transportation. The object of the present invention is to provide a tool holder that can be held without any problems.

(Effects of the invention) As described above, according to the tool receiver according to the invention, at least three parts of the peripheral wall of the cylindrical body having an inner diameter into which the largest diameter tool can be fitted are made to protrude outward. A bulge is formed, and a support whose end face position can be changed bit by bit by teeth and grooves is inserted into this bulge, and a tool is driven by the end faces of three or more supports. Because it is designed to hold, unlike conventional two-point holders,
It can securely hold even extremely small diameter tools, the receiver body and support are separate, and its structure is simple, so it has great practical effects such as being suitable for mass production. .
